a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orKim Phillips <kim.phillips@freescale.com>2011-05-14 23:07:55 -0400
committerHerbert Xu <herbert@gondor.apana.org.au>2011-05-19 00:37:58 -0400
commit2930d49768e5276da4fbed9d9cc1bd40ed25818e (patch)
tree553bbd7cfcde38858222ff275f4f85d54b6dda18
parent9bed4aca296fdf9c1b85a8f093e92018dc9864f3 (diff)
crypto: caam - platform_bus_type migration
this fixes a build error since cryptodev-2.6 got rebased to include commit d714d1979d7b4df7e2c127407f4014ce71f73cd0 "dt: eliminate of_platform_driver shim code". Signed-off-by: Kim Phillips <kim.phillips@freescale.com>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
-rw-r--r--drivers/crypto/caam/ctrl.c9
1 files changed, 4 insertions, 5 deletions
diff --git a/drivers/crypto/caam/ctrl.c b/drivers/crypto/caam/ctrl.c
index 59aae4e3b54b..9009713a3c2e 100644
--- a/drivers/crypto/caam/ctrl.c
+++ b/drivers/crypto/caam/ctrl.c
@@ -44,8 +44,7 @@ static int caam_remove(struct platform_device *pdev)
44} 44}
45 45
46/* Probe routine for CAAM top (controller) level */ 46/* Probe routine for CAAM top (controller) level */
47static int caam_probe(struct platform_device *pdev, 47static int caam_probe(struct platform_device *pdev)
48 const struct of_device_id *devmatch)
49{ 48{
50 int d, ring, rspec; 49 int d, ring, rspec;
51 struct device *dev; 50 struct device *dev;
@@ -242,7 +241,7 @@ static struct of_device_id caam_match[] = {
242}; 241};
243MODULE_DEVICE_TABLE(of, caam_match); 242MODULE_DEVICE_TABLE(of, caam_match);
244 243
245static struct of_platform_driver caam_driver = { 244static struct platform_driver caam_driver = {
246 .driver = { 245 .driver = {
247 .name = "caam", 246 .name = "caam",
248 .owner = THIS_MODULE, 247 .owner = THIS_MODULE,
@@ -254,12 +253,12 @@ static struct of_platform_driver caam_driver = {
254 253
255static int __init caam_base_init(void) 254static int __init caam_base_init(void)
256{ 255{
257 return of_register_platform_driver(&caam_driver); 256 return platform_driver_register(&caam_driver);
258} 257}
259 258
260static void __exit caam_base_exit(void) 259static void __exit caam_base_exit(void)
261{ 260{
262 return of_unregister_platform_driver(&caam_driver); 261 return platform_driver_unregister(&caam_driver);
263} 262}
264 263
265module_init(caam_base_init); 264module_init(caam_base_init);